Ok straight to the point:
I am looking for a 3ART29VAA2P thermostat for my zanussi because the one it has right now it will never turn the heater on and the fridge is full of frost. I made a small research and I found out that this thermostat has these specifications:

cold out -32,0° C
warm out: -12,5° C
constant: +4,5° C

It is similar to Ranco K 59 - L 2534 according to this page:
http://www.europart-service.de/katalog/dokumente/kuehl-_gefriergeraete_thermostate_spezial_-_thermostate/thermostat_kg_ranco_304771.htm

I found on a local store some thermostats that say Ranco K59 and have these specs:

Cold out -26c, Warm out -11c, Defrost termination +3.5c* (*constant cut in). Capillary length 1200mm

My question is: CAN I USE THEM?
